The ideal temperature for your new heat pump is determined by what you find comfy, the climatic condition in your area, and the efficiency of your system. In general, set your thermostat to 20 degrees Celsius in the cold season and 26 degrees Celsius in the warmer months. You can save energy by reducing the temperature while sleeping or away from home. Always keep in mind that setting your thermostat to either too high or too low can decrease your heat pump’s efficiency. It is critical to strike the proper balance for your requirements.

Depending on the setup and the characteristics included, heat pumps can be completely automated. Many advanced heat pumps are built with intelligent control features that enable them to function instantly without the user’s continuous supervision or modification. All in all, the degree of automation in a heat pump is determined by the manufacturer and model, in addition to the capabilities included.
